I've just returned from a shoot, and I saw the images on both camera's LCD screens, so I know the captures were ok. I've downloaded the images from both memory cards to the computer. I converted the raw images captured on one card to TIFFs as usual, however when I tried to convert the images from the second card
neither Canon file viewer nor Photoshop CS could see the images.


I've opened the folder containing the image files and the closed files look normal, ie they are the correct size, so the information should be there. I've put the offending card back in both cameras, and I can tell by the number of images the cameras say are still available to shoot that the files are still on the card. However the camera LCDs will no longer display the images - if I try that I get the message "no images", which is obviously wrong. I've also shot some test images on the apparently faulty card and downloaded those to the computer - they display ok.

So apparently the card is still working, apparently the assignment images are still on the card and also on the computer, but I can't find any way to read them.

Help!!! The cameras are Canon EOS 10Ds, the card is a Kingston 1 gig and I'm working on Mac OSX.
